G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 21-30 Create two servers 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 Use the :func:`start_local_server() ` method to start two servers on your local machine. If you have another server, you can use the :func:`connect_to_server() ` method to connect to any DPF server on your network. The ``as_global`` attributes allows you to choose whether a server is stored by the module and used by default. This example sets the first server as the default. .. G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 30-39 .. code-block:: Python server1 = dpf.start_local_server(as_global=True, config=dpf.AvailableServerConfigs.GrpcServer) server2 = dpf.start_local_server(as_global=False, config=dpf.AvailableServerConfigs.GrpcServer) # Check that the two servers are listening on different ports. print( server1.port if hasattr(server1, "port") else "", server2.port if hasattr(server2, "port") else "", ) .. rst-class:: sphx-glr-script-out .. code-block:: none 50054 50055 .. G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 40-45 Send the result file 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 The result file is sent to the temporary directory of the first server. This file upload is useless in this case because the two servers are local machines. .. G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 45-47 .. code-block:: Python file_path_in_tmp = examples.find_complex_rst(server=server1) .. G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 48-51 Create a workflow on the first server 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 Create the model .. G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 51-57 .. code-block:: Python model = dpf.Model(file_path_in_tmp) # Read displacement disp = model.results.displacement() disp.inputs.time_scoping(len(model.metadata.time_freq_support.time_frequencies)) .. G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 58-60 Create a workflow on the second server 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 .. G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 60-73 .. code-block:: Python # Change the Cartesian coordinates to cylindrical coordinates cs coordinates = ops.geo.rotate_in_cylindrical_cs_fc(server=server2) # Create the Cartesian coordinate cs cs = dpf.fields_factory.create_scalar_field(12, server=server2) cs.data = [1, 0, 0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0] coordinates.inputs.coordinate_system(cs) # Choose the radial component to plot comp = dpf.operators.logic.component_selector_fc(coordinates, 0, server=server2) .. G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 74-76 Pass data from one server to another 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 .. GENERATED FROM PYTHON SOURCE LINES 76-86 .. code-block:: Python fc_disp = disp.outputs.fields_container() fc_copy = fc_disp.deep_copy(server=server2) mesh_copy = model.metadata.meshed_region.deep_copy(server=server2) # give a mesh to the field fc_copy[0].meshed_region = mesh_copy fc_copy[1].meshed_region = mesh_copy coordinates.inputs.field(fc_copy) ..
